Do-it-Yourself Metal Polishing Tips
The Basics of Metal Polishing - Generally, the finishing of metal is necessary for appearance and for clean-room usages. It is one of the more accepted techniques because of its effectiveness in improving upon the overall beauty of the item, such as, kitchenware, car parts or motorbike parts. Moreover, a lot of clean-rooms must have a burnished finish to lessen the porosity of the components that could cause particles to build up and contaminate. A great instance of this practice would be in a vacuum chamber. There are certainly a variety of different ways to finish metals, and we can investigate some of the methods required. Various metals can be burnished manually by hand, using special buffing machines, electromechanically or employing chemicals. A particular finishing paste or compound is generally put into use, which might contain dolomite, chromium oxide, chalk, limestone, aluminum oxide, tripoli, or iron oxide. Polishing stainless steel, because of its substandard thermal conductivity, its hardness, and its comparatively high viscidity is just about the time intensive. More over, items manufactured from non-ferrous metal tend to be more amenable to polishing, since they require the lower amount of processes.
When a greater processing quality is not really mandatory, swifter pad speeds should be employed. A reduced pad speed is needed if a good quality mirror finish is required. Finishing buffs smothered in paste can be seriously impacted by specific pressures on the buffing pad. The vigour of the pressure on the surface may be increased within certain guidelines, however overreaching the most effective level of force not merely cuts down the quality of treatment, but additionally reduces the level of performance, can bring about wear on the component, and also an evident heating up of the pieces being worked on, an outcome of friction. When working thinner pieces, it's raised temperature (and the relating flexibility of the material) that cause components to buckle, twist or flex. In general, it takes a qualified polisher to consider every one of these points to both not cause harm to the metal part and to deliver the results competently. To radically enhance the quality of the final surface, the finishing operation must be completed with a lesser amount of aggression and not as much pressure so as to consequently deliver a surface with no scratches or marks which result from the buffing procedure, therefore ending up with a beautiful mirror finish.
